The First Day: Arrival and Major Highlights
Upon arriving in Amritsar around 1:30 PM, your guide will assist in transferring you to your hotel. Depending on your chosen hotel class (4 or 5-star options), you can expect a comfortable base to unwind after your morning travel. The tour then moves quickly but meaningfully into visiting the Wagah Border in the late afternoon. This border ceremony is renowned for its theatrical display of patriotism, with soldiers performing synchronized drills and the flag-lowering parade that draws crowds from both India and Pakistan. It’s an event filled with energy, pageantry, and national pride—an absolute must-see.
Following this, many travelers opt for a traditional Punjabi dinner at a local restaurant. The food is hearty, flavorful, and a perfect way to end the day. For those who want a more atmospheric experience, there’s an optional visit to Golden Temple at night (extra charges apply), where the shimmering golden façade is lit beautifully, and the peaceful aura is palpable after sunset.
The Second Day: Spiritual, Historical, and Cultural Insights
Your mornings start with a breakfast at the hotel before heading to Golden Temple —the heart of Sikh spirituality. The temple’s stunning architecture, shimmering with gold and marble, is a visual feast. We loved the guide’s explanations about the significance of the complex and the indoor pools used for purification rituals. Witnessing the evening prayer ceremony adds a communal, almost meditative layer to your visit.
Next, a visit to Jallianwala Bagh offers a sobering but essential historical perspective. The gardens commemorate the tragic 1919 massacre, and the guides often share thoughtful insights into its impact on India’s independence movement. According to reviews, visitors find the site emotional but invaluable for understanding the country’s struggles.
Later, you’ll have time to explore local markets—a lively, colorful display of Punjabi textiles, handicrafts, and souvenirs. It’s an excellent chance to pick up authentic gifts and experience the vibrant local color firsthand. The guide’s commentary often enhances this experience, sharing stories behind the crafts and traditions.
As late afternoon approaches, you’ll reboard the Shatabdi Express for your return to Delhi, arriving around 10:50 PM. The train journey back provides a relaxed space to reflect on your visit and discuss highlights.

FAQs
How do I get to the hotel from Delhi?
The tour includes pickup at your Delhi hotel, Noida, Gurugram, or at the airport, with a driver meeting you at the arrival hall, making initial logistics easy.
What should I bring?
You’ll need your passport, visa (if required), and some cash for optional extras or souvenirs.
Is this tour suitable for children or pregnant women?
Pregnant women are advised against this tour. For children, it depends on their stamina, given the busy schedule and early mornings.
How is the train journey?
The Shatabdi Express is a fast, comfortable train, providing a relaxed way to travel between Delhi and Amritsar.
Can I cancel the tour?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ering flexibility if travel plans change.
Are meals included?
Breakfast is included at the hotel; dinner at a local restaurant is optional and not included in the price.
What is the hotel accommodation like?
Hotels vary from 4-star to 5-star options, depending on availability, providing clean, comfortable spaces after busy days of sightseeing.
Is the tour suitable for solo travelers?
Absolutely, the private group format is welcoming for solo travelers seeking a more intimate experience.
What about local markets?
Expect vibrant markets where you can shop for textiles, handicrafts, and souvenirs—perfect for picking up authentic Punjabi crafts.
How long does each site visit last?
The schedule is quite packed, with time allocated for sightseeing, reflection, and shopping, but expect some sites to be more brief than leisurely visits.
